PROFESSIONAL DEVELOPMENT
We believe that the most promising strategy for achieving the mission of the Epping School District is to function as a professional learning community focusing on learning, collaborative culture, and results. This will require school and district structures, staff, and resources to be aligned in support of the professional learning community.
The Professional Development Master Plan has been approved by NH Department of Education and is in effect until June 30, 2016.
The Epping School District Professional Development Master Plan - The PD Master Plan (see link below) documents the process by which Epping School Staff are renewed for NH Department of Education certification. The Master Plan has recently been revised to meet the NH Department of Education guidlelines.
The Professional Learning Organization - The Professional Learning Organization Chart shows how professional learning fits into the district organization, what professional learning structures are in place, and what roles these structures play.
